Clara OCR

Clara OCR is an Optical Character Recognition program. It features both a powerful GUI for the X Window System, and a Web interface. The Web interface is able to collect revision efforts from the Internet, using a simple revision model. It is intended to be used in the cooperative optical recognition of old books. It tries to facilitate fine- tuning, so an optical recognition project is enabled to invest resources in tuning the OCR, in order to achieve better recognition results for one specific book, and reduce the overall revision cost.

  •  05 May 2002 01:44

    Release Notes: This version adds grayscale native support (PGM format), plus four binarization methods. It also adds an internal preprocessor including deskewing, balancing, thresholding, and interpolation, and has been packaged for NetBSD. There are various new features including border path computing, barcode search, detection of extremities, PAGE only mode, the flea, the spyhole, instant threshold, per-depth optimized X code, many bugfixes, and other interface enhancements. The documentation was updated (but not finished), and a glossary was added.

    •  21 Oct 2001 02:27

    Release Notes: Thresholding facility, new classifier, and two new skeleton-computing heuristics added. The Advanced User's Guide (partially finished) was carefully updated. FreeBSD support, various bugfixes, and skeleton speed enhancements added.
